I don't think the power steering fluid runs through the radiator.... I think it's endgine oil on driver side and tranny fluid on passenger side....could be wrong on that though.
In any event, if your radiator is failing you need to get an external tranny cooler installed yesterday. It's a known issue and if the radiator fails on the tranny fluid side you will have a catastrophic failure of your tranny and cooling system. That equals big $$$.
